SCI
Rehab Services Incorporated Society was founded on the 24th day of
November 2004 to assist spinal cord injured people gain maximum mobility
and quality of life through rehabilitation.
SCI Rehab Services Incorporated Society is a non profit organization.
The society’s objectives are:
1. To promote exercise therapy for Spinal Cord Injured
persons.
2. To implement programmes to enhance wellness and mobility for
physically disabled persons.
3. To raise funds to assist the work of the society.
4. To re-activate the Central nervous system of people with Spinal
Cord Injuries and work towards full recovery for them.
5. To employ researchers and/or exercise specialists to assist in
recovery programmes.
6. To fund research relevant to these objects being carried out
whether in New Zealand or elsewhere.
7. To subscribe to, become a member of, affiliate with and/or cooperate
with any society or
organisation having amongst its objects similar objects to those
of the society, and/or assist in the foundation and incorporation
of any society or organisation, whether as an independent society,
or whether formed to federate with other societies including this
society, or otherwise whether in New Zealand or overseas.
8. To adopt any such other objects as may be necessary for the Society
to carry out its main aim.
The society actively seeks funding from various trusts to allow
the work of the society as mentioned above and to support individuals
with SCI reach their full potential in terms of rehabilitation.
